While "chatting" with the owner he mentioned the importance of using a company that is properly insured and many of the services that pickup at curbside is really just a person with a car.

Look for companies that pickup in the Express Pickup area, they are licensed by MCO and need to be properly insured.

Uber/Lyft is different, they are curbside but properly insured.

The Express Pickup lane is below Baggage Claim, behind the rental car counters. It’s an indoor lane reserved for car services picking up their clients. Cars are inspected by security upon entry. Companies/chauffeurs have to pay to park there.
Chauffeurs are supposed to go up to baggage claim from there and have a meet-and-greet sign. It’s a really nice perk because they don’t get caught in the crazy traffic that Level 2 (Arrivals) can have.
It’s open from 8am to midnight; for any pickups between midnight and 8am, chauffeurs have to park in the commercial lot across the bus lane, and walk the client over to the car. Taller vehicles (over 7 feet) have to use the bus lane/commercial lot regardless.

I said I would report back, and here I am.

Things with Tony's drivers ran relatively smoothly.

Riland was who we had round trip between Disney and the airport and he was great. The van itself was nothing fancy, but it was comfortable and enough room for the 7 of us. The van actually had another company's name on it, which makes sense, as I've heard that Tony subs some rides out. I looked up this particular company, and their prices are very reasonable...not to take any business from Tony, but I would absolutely use this gentleman again. We did get the Express pickup at MCO which was nice.

We made it from MCO to the Polynesian in around 30-35 minutes. Great time. The best part was on the return trip being dropped off right at the ticketing counters and not having to drag our luggage across the airport to drop off, then back across the airport to go through security and get to our gate.

We also used Tony from Port Canaveral to Disney for a one way trip. I didn't catch the driver's name, but I will admit...his driving did have me a bit nervous at times. Now, in all fairness, the traffic once we hit MCO until we got to Disney was crazy. And, we saw some pretty crazy drivers weaving in and out. So...I think the driver knew what he was doing as far as navigating the crazy traffic. I think someone previously in this thread had mentioned a driver that was kind of wild....not sure if it was the same one.

Neither driver talked politics. They made polite conversation, but they let us converse amongst ourselves and then played music otherwise.

Tony did call a couple of days.before to iron out the details, so that was nice. All in all, things went pretty well.
